Integrative medicine, the idea that health solutions can come from multiple health disciplines, is an important concept to explore.  Medical doctors, counselors, therapists, chiropractors, nutritionists, and naturopaths are all trained in different aspects of healthcare. Integrative medicine promotes the idea that one can seek care from multiple fields in health.
